Document background
The Founder Exit Agreement is a crucial document used when a founding member decides to leave or is required to leave their company in Switzerland. This agreement is essential for companies at various stages of growth, from early-stage startups to established enterprises, where a founder's departure needs to be formally documented and executed. The agreement covers comprehensive aspects including share transfers, valuation mechanisms, post-exit obligations, and transition arrangements, all while ensuring compliance with Swiss legal requirements. It's particularly important as it helps prevent future disputes by clearly defining the terms of separation, protecting both the departing founder's interests and the company's future operations. The document must comply with Swiss corporate law, particularly the Swiss Code of Obligations, and should address specific Swiss tax implications and regulatory requirements.
Suggested Sections

1. Parties: Identification of the departing founder, the company, and other relevant parties (e.g., remaining shareholders)

2. Background: Context of the founder's involvement, current shareholding, and reasons for exit

3. Definitions: Definitions of key terms used throughout the agreement

4. Resignation and Release from Positions: Terms of the founder's resignation from all positions (director, officer, employee, etc.)

5. Share Transfer Terms: Details of the transfer of the founder's shares, including pricing, payment terms, and mechanics

6. Consideration and Payment Terms: Specification of the exit package, including cash consideration, deferred payments, and any other financial benefits

7. Handover and Transition: Process and obligations for transitioning responsibilities and company materials

8. Confidentiality: Ongoing obligations regarding confidential information

9. Non-Competition and Non-Solicitation: Post-exit restrictions on competitive activities and solicitation of employees/customers

10. Intellectual Property Rights: Confirmation of IP ownership and transfer of any remaining rights

11. Tax Matters: Allocation of tax responsibilities and related obligations

12. Representations and Warranties: Standard representations from both parties

13. General Provisions: Standard boilerplate clauses including governing law, jurisdiction, entire agreement, etc.

14. Execution: Signature blocks and execution requirements

Optional Sections

1. Earnout Provisions: Include when part of the exit consideration is contingent on future performance

2. Ongoing Advisory Role: Include when the founder will continue in an advisory capacity

3. Share Option Treatment: Include when there are outstanding share options or other equity instruments

4. Company Loans and Debts: Include when there are outstanding loans or debts between founder and company

5. Personal Guarantees: Include when founder has provided personal guarantees that need to be released

6. Future Financing Rounds: Include when addressing founder's rights in future funding rounds

7. Dispute Resolution: Include when parties prefer arbitration or specific dispute resolution mechanisms

8. Insurance and Indemnification: Include when addressing ongoing D&O insurance coverage or specific indemnification terms

Suggested Schedules

1. Schedule of Shares: Detailed list of shares and other equity instruments being transferred

2. Calculation of Consideration: Detailed breakdown of exit package calculation

3. Company Positions: List of all positions held by founder to be resigned from

4. Handover Checklist: Detailed list of items, accounts, and materials to be handed over

5. Company IP: Schedule of relevant IP rights and confirmations

6. Outstanding Loans and Obligations: Details of any loans, guarantees, or other financial obligations

7. Required Third Party Consents: List of required consents and approvals for the exit

8. Form of Resignation Letters: Templates for various resignation letters required

9. Form of Public Announcement: Agreed form of any public or internal announcements regarding the exit
